Abstract: A wire fixation apparatus and a display device are provided. The wire fixation apparatus includes: a first snap structure, half surrounding a wire and provided with a first opening at a side thereof; a second snap structure, half surrounding a wire and provided with a second opening at a side thereof; and an auxiliary installation plate connecting the first snap structure to the second snap structure. The first opening of the first snap structure is opposite to the second opening of the second snap structure. The first snap structure, the second snap structure and the auxiliary installation plate together form a wire channel for the wire to pass therethrough, and an interval is arranged between the first snap structure and the second snap structure to enable the wire to be snapped into the wire channel through the interval. Projections of the first snap structure, the second snap structure and the auxiliary installation plate onto a first projection plane together encircle a projection of the wire onto the first projection plane. The first projection plane is a plane of a cross section of the wire.

Abstract: The present invention provides a double-sided touch control substrate, a double-sided touch control device and a double-sided touch control display device. The double-sided touch control substrate comprises a base having a first side and a second side opposite to each other, a first touch control mechanism is provided on the first side, and a second touch control mechanism is provided on the second side. Both the first touch control mechanism and the second touch control mechanism are connected to a touch control driving unit through a switching mechanism, and the switching mechanism enables the first touch control mechanism and the second touch control mechanism to share the touch control driving unit in a time-sharing manner. With the double-sided touch control substrate, a streamlined touch-control device that is not limited to single-sided touch control is implemented by using fewer resources.

Abstract: Holographic display device and operation method thereof are provided. A holographic display device includes a light source device including a plurality of, light sources; and an imager including a plurality of imaging regions each corresponding to one light source. The imager includes at least one spatial light modulator configured to receive light from the plurality of light sources to form a plurality of holographic images.

Abstract: Holographic operation equipment, including: a holographic image generating device configured to generate holographic image information including an operated object; an operation device configured to operate the operated object; an image transmitting device configured to transmit the holographic image information; and an information receiving device configured to receive a control signal and send the control signal to the operation device to control the operation of the operation device. The operation error resulted in panel displaying can be reduced. A holographic control equipment, a holographic operation method, a holographic control method and a telemedicine system are further provided.

Abstract: An image display system is provided. The image display system includes: at least one holographic image acquiring device each configured to obtain holographic image information of a scene; an image synthesis device configured to generate holographic image synthesis information based on at least a part of the holographic image information obtained by the at least one holographic image acquiring device; and an image reconstruction device configured to reconstruct a holographic synthetic image in accordance with the holographic image synthesis information. The image display system can synthesize holographic image information to combine several holographic three-dimensional display scenes into one holographic three-dimensional scene, so that the user can perceive display effects almost the same as the real scenes, improving user experience. An image display method is also provided.

Abstract: A diffusion sheet, a backlight module and a liquid crystal module are disclosed. The diffusion sheet comprises a paper fiber layer (1) with surfaces on two sides both disposed with a light-transmissive protection layer (2, 3). The diffusion sheet can well diffuse light passing through the diffusion sheet, and hence improve uniformity of light passing through the diffusion sheet. A paper fiber layer (1) is employed in the diffusion sheet for diffusion, which makes a paper fiber layer (1) be prepared at a low cost and have a small weight, and hence reduce the preparation cost and weight of a diffusion sheet to provided convenience for transfer of a product.

Abstract: A pressure sensor, a touch substrate and a touch display device are provided. The pressure sensor includes: an active layer; a gate electrode, which is stacked with the active layer and insulated from the active layer; an elastic layer, which is arranged between the active layer and the gate electrode in a direction perpendicular to the active layer, and a thickness of the elastic layer is decreased in a case that a pressure is applied to the pressure sensor; and a source electrode and a drain electrode, which are spaced from each other and are both electrically connected with the active layer.
